G.I. Joe Classified Series Cobra Pilot & Cobra C.L.A.W.





Cobra's air support just got a serious upgrade. The Classified Series pairs a Cobra Pilot figure with the C.L.A.W., Cobra's Covert Light Aerial Weapon, and the vehicle alone is packed with playable detail: retractable landing gear on rolling wheels, canards and wing tips that pivot, and a turret that swivels with a barrel that angles up and down. The pilot comes loaded too, nine accessories including a removable helmet, two alternate heads, and a figure stand to keep him steady in the cockpit. G.I. Joe Classified Series Pythona





Cobra-La's royal messenger has landed in the Classified Series line. Pythona comes dressed for G.I. Joe: The Movie, with an alternate ponytail head, twin chakrams, and a set of swappable hands including a poison effect and a smoke effect. She also carries five bio-mechanical creature accessories that double as weapons, a fitting nod to how unhinged Cobra-La always looked next to the rest of Cobra. Pythona is King Golobulus's emissary and one of Cobra-La's most skilled assassins, and this figure leans into that with a loadout built for stealth and infiltration. Super7 G.I. Joe Comic Collector Series Snake Eyes

Snake Eyes gets the comic treatment with Super7's newest ReAction+ box set, which pairs the 3.75 inch figure with an actual reprint of issue #2 from 1982's Panic at the North Pole story. This version wears his mask, since rumor has it he spent eight hours in a sensory deprivation tank before this mission, and he comes armed with a weasel skull necklace, a backpack, and a rifle. With 12 points of articulation he holds a pose better than most figures at this price. Only 5,000 sets exist, priced at $29.99 and shipping late October, so this is one to grab before it's gone.

Mondo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les The Shredder





Shredder steps into Mondo's TMNT: MondoVerse 1/6 line as the villain that started it all, leading the Foot Clan with interchangeable portraits and removable armor over fabric costume pieces. He comes loaded with his signature weapons plus a set of Krang inspired accessories, a fun touch that ties him to the wider MondoVerse story.
